Tarangire National Park

Tarangire National Park

Your safari begins with a pick-up from your accommodation or Kilimanjaro/Arusha Airport, followed by a comfortable transfer to Tarangire National Park, one of Tanzania’s most wildlife-rich parks. Famous for its large elephant herds, iconic baobab trees, and the life-giving Tarangire River, the park is home to lions, giraffes, zebras, wildebeests, and numerous bird species. Enjoy a morning game drive, followed by lunch at a scenic picnic site, then continue with an afternoon game drive before transferring to your luxury lodge for dinner and relaxation.

Tarangire to Serengeti National Park

Tarangire to Serengeti National Park

After breakfast, you will depart to your accommodation and drive to the legendary Serengeti National Park, one of Africa’s most famous wildlife destinations, renowned for its endless golden plains and the Big Five. Along the way, enjoy scenic landscapes and optional game spotting. Upon arrival, have lunch at a designated site, then embark on an afternoon game drive across the Serengeti’s diverse ecosystems, where you may encounter lions, leopards, elephants, cheetahs, and countless other wildlife species. In the evening, transfer to your luxury camp for dinner and an overnight stay.

Serengeti to Ngorongoro Crater

Serengeti to Ngorongoro Crater

After breakfast, you will depart the Serengeti and drive toward the spectacular Ngorongoro Crater, a UNESCO World Heritage site and the world’s largest intact volcanic caldera, renowned for its dramatic scenery and exceptionally high concentration of wildlife. Upon arrival, enjoy a morning game drive in the crater, spotting lions, elephants, rhinos, buffalo, zebras, and many other species thriving in this unique ecosystem. Lunch will be served at a scenic site in the crater, followed by an afternoon game drive to explore more of its stunning landscapes and diverse wildlife. In the evening, transfer to your luxury lodge for dinner and an overnight stay.

Lake Manyara National Park to Arusha

Lake Manyara National Park to Arusha

After breakfast, you will depart your lodge and drive to Lake Manyara National Park, a stunning park renowned for its soda lake, lush groundwater forests, and the rare tree-climbing lions. The park also hosts large herds of elephants, giraffes, zebras, hippos, and thousands of flamingos, making it a birdwatcher’s paradise. Enjoy a morning game drive, spotting wildlife against the park’s dramatic escarpment and lakeshore scenery. After lunch at a scenic picnic site, embark on a scenic drive back to your Arusha lodge, where you will enjoy dinner and an overnight stay.
